Pytho官网
Pytho官网
Pytho 官网 (python.org) 是学习、下载和参与 Python编程语言 开发的官方资源中心。它不仅提供最新的 Python版本 下载,还包含详尽的文档、教程、社区信息以及关于 Python基金会 的相关介绍。对于任何希望学习或使用 Python 的开发者来说,Pytho官网都是不可或缺的起点。
概述
Pytho官网是Python语言及其生态系统的核心枢纽。它最初由 Guido van Rossum 创建,并由 Python 软件基金会维护。网站的设计目标是为用户提供一个全面、易于访问的资源库,涵盖 Python 的各个方面。从初学者入门教程到高级开发指南,Pytho官网力求满足不同水平用户的需求。网站内容涵盖了 Python 的历史、设计理念、应用领域以及未来的发展方向。它还提供了一个平台,供 Python 社区成员分享知识、交流经验和协作开发。
网站的结构清晰,导航便捷。用户可以通过搜索功能快速找到所需的信息。网站还支持多种语言,方便全球用户访问。Pytho官网定期更新,以反映 Python 语言的最新发展和社区的最新动态。它也是 Python 官方发布公告和新闻稿的渠道。
主要特点
Pytho官网拥有诸多特点,使其成为 Python 开发者首选的资源中心:
- *全面的文档*: 网站提供详尽的Python文档,涵盖了语言的各个方面,包括语法、标准库、API 参考等。
- *丰富的教程*: 网站提供各种级别的教程,从初学者入门到高级开发,帮助用户快速掌握 Python 编程技能。
- *活跃的社区*: 网站链接到活跃的 Python 社区,包括邮件列表、论坛、IRC 频道等,方便用户交流经验和寻求帮助。
- *官方下载*: 网站提供最新的 Python下载,用户可以根据自己的操作系统和需求选择合适的版本。
- *新闻和公告*: 网站发布 Python 的最新新闻和公告,让用户及时了解 Python 的发展动态。
- *Python基金会信息*: 网站提供关于 Python基金会 的信息,包括基金会的使命、成员、项目等。
- *包索引 (PyPI) 链接*: 方便用户访问 PyPI,查找和安装第三方 Python 包。
- *开发者资源*: 提供开发者工具、调试器、性能分析器等资源链接。
- *PEP 规范*: 可以查阅 PEP (Python Enhancement Proposals) 规范,了解 Python 语言的发展方向。
- *成功案例展示*: 展示 Python 在各个领域的成功应用案例,激发用户的学习兴趣。
使用方法
访问 Pytho官网非常简单。用户只需在浏览器中输入网址 python.org 即可。网站的导航菜单位于页面顶部,用户可以通过点击菜单项访问不同的页面。
1. **下载 Python**: 在 "Downloads" 菜单下,用户可以找到适用于不同操作系统的 Python 下载链接。选择合适的版本并按照提示进行安装。 2. **查阅文档**: 在 "Documentation" 菜单下,用户可以找到 Python 的官方文档。文档按照版本进行组织,用户可以选择自己使用的版本进行查阅。文档包含教程、语言参考、库参考等内容。 3. **参与社区**: 在 "Community" 菜单下,用户可以找到 Python 社区的各种资源,包括邮件列表、论坛、IRC 频道等。用户可以在这些平台上与其他 Python 开发者交流经验和寻求帮助。 4. **了解 Python 基金会**: 在 "About" 菜单下,用户可以找到关于 Python 基金会的信息。了解基金会的使命、成员和项目,可以帮助用户更好地了解 Python 语言的生态系统。 5. **搜索信息**: 网站提供搜索功能,用户可以通过输入关键词快速找到所需的信息。搜索结果会显示相关的文档、教程、新闻和公告。 6. **浏览新闻**: 在 "News" 页面,可以查看 Python 语言的最新动态和发展趋势。 7. **查找软件包**: 通过链接访问 PyPI,搜索并安装所需的第三方软件包。 8. **学习 Python 教程**: 在 "Tutorials" 页面,可以找到适合不同水平的 Python 教程。 9. **参与 Python 开发**: 了解 PEP 规范,并参与 Python 语言的改进和发展。 10. **贡献代码**: 通过 GitHub 等平台参与 Python 核心代码的贡献。
相关策略
Pytho官网提供的资源可以与其他学习和开发策略相结合,以提高学习效率和开发质量。
- **与其他在线学习平台结合**: Pytho官网的教程可以与其他在线学习平台,如 Coursera、Udemy、edX 等,相结合,形成更全面的学习体系。这些平台通常提供更结构化的课程和更丰富的练习。
- **结合实际项目进行学习**: 学习 Python 的最佳方法是将其应用于实际项目中。Pytho官网提供的文档和教程可以帮助用户解决在项目开发中遇到的问题。
- **参与开源项目**: 参与开源项目可以帮助用户学习到更高级的 Python 编程技巧,并与其他开发者合作。
- **阅读 Python 代码**: 阅读优秀的 Python 代码可以帮助用户学习到最佳实践和设计模式。
- **使用版本控制系统**: 使用 Git 等版本控制系统可以帮助用户管理代码,并与其他开发者协作。
- **使用集成开发环境 (IDE)**: 使用 PyCharm、VS Code 等 IDE 可以提高开发效率。
- **利用调试器**: 使用调试器可以帮助用户找到代码中的错误。
- **进行代码审查**: 进行代码审查可以帮助用户发现潜在的问题。
- **使用代码分析工具**: 使用代码分析工具可以帮助用户提高代码质量。
- **参与 Python 社区**: 积极参与 Python 社区可以帮助用户学习到最新的技术和最佳实践。
- **学习设计模式**: 学习常用的设计模式可以帮助用户编写更可维护和可扩展的代码。
- **使用测试框架**: 使用 unittest、pytest 等测试框架可以帮助用户确保代码的质量。
- **学习性能优化技巧**: 学习性能优化技巧可以帮助用户提高 Python 代码的执行效率。
- **关注 Python 社区动态**: 关注 Python 社区动态可以帮助用户了解最新的技术和发展趋势。
- **阅读 PEP 规范**: 阅读 PEP 规范可以帮助用户了解 Python 语言的发展方向。
以下是一个展示 Python 版本历史的 MediaWiki 表格:
版本 | 发布日期 | 主要特性 |
---|---|---|
0.9.0 | 1991年2月 | 基础版本,类、异常处理、函数 |
1.0 | 1994年1月 | lambda、map、filter、reduce |
2.0 | 2000年10月 | 列表推导式、垃圾回收 |
2.7 | 2010年7月 | 最终的 2.x 版本 |
3.0 | 2008年12月 | Unicode 字符串、print 函数变为函数 |
3.6 | 2016年12月 | f-strings、数据类 |
3.7 | 2018年6月 | 数据类改进、异步迭代器 |
3.8 | 2019年10月 | 海象运算符、位置参数 |
3.9 | 2020年10月 | 字典合并运算符、类型提示改进 |
3.10 | 2021年10月 | 结构化模式匹配 |
3.11 | 2022年10月 | 更快的性能、更好的错误信息 |
Python Python编程语言 Python版本 文档 教程 社区 Python基金会 PyPI PEP Coursera Udemy edX Git PyCharm VS Code unittest pytest
立即开始交易
注册IQ Option (最低入金 $10) 开设Pocket Option账户 (最低入金 $5)
加入我们的社区
关注我们的Telegram频道 @strategybin,获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教学资料